Understanding Anxiety and Depression: Resources for Support and Healing
Anxiety and depression are common mental health conditions that can significantly impact a person's life. These disorders often manifest as persistent feelings of worry, sadness, hopelessness, and tiredness. Seeking help is crucial for managing these conditions and recovering. Fortunately, there are numerous resources available to people struggling with anxiety and depression.
- Therapy: A licensed therapist can offer helpful treatment options such as c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) or interpersonal therapy.
- Support groups: Connecting with others who understand what you're going through can be incredibly beneficial.
- Medication: In some cases, a doctor may prescribe medication to help manage symptoms.
- Lifestyle changes: Engaging in regular exercise, eating a balanced diet, and getting enough sleep can benefit mental health.
Remember that you're not alone, and there is support available. Reaching out for help is a sign of strength, and taking steps toward healing can lead to a more fulfilling life.
